Is Sarah Palin A Poster Child for Success?

November 20, 2009

This week Sarah Palin’s books hit the market and talk about a fanfare! Whether you love her or hate her (and there are few who are in the middle) you have to admit she makes us all take a deep breath and ponder what does success means today.
 
On the one hand, she has a following in conservative groups because she says what they’re thinking and stands up to the “liberal media and liberal agenda”. Political movers and shakers in the Republican Party are all aghast that she just won’t go away quietly. And her book, which sounds like a tell all on the makings of a presidential candidate, is causing a firestorm of conversations. 
 
So what are the lessons on success we can learn when you step out of the emotionalism surrounding her? Who really defines what is successful – the public, leaders in an organization or the person? After years of research we know success is defined by the individual. So…What are the possibilities for Mrs. Palin’s future job success? 
 
a)      Everyone is asking, “Is she preparing to mount a bid to be the 2012 Presidential candidate for the Republican Party”. Since Mrs. Palin went “rouge” it is clear that she has bigger aspirations than to be the governor of Alaska, a mother, a wife and a moose hunter.  Being President is just one goal but there are a lot of others for her to consider.
b)      There are people who think she’s looking at a possible talk show, movie deal or news commentary position in her future or
c)       Of course she could be looking to form a “Mavericks R Us or Going Rouge” coalition with people who believe she’s just right on a number of issues that no one wants to talk about. Issues like, Levi Johnston is simply being used and selling tantalizing photos of his body is wrong, government spending that leads to high deficits is wrong, expecting politicians to go to Washington for the right reasons, and not just to mingle with the right people.
 
The truth is no one knows how she defines or measures success but she has all the hallmarks of one who will be successful.
 
1)      Passion- no matter what you think of her politics Sarah Palin is passionate about stirring the pot and influencing politics. She has consistently demonstrated excitement, drive and stick-to-it-ness in spite of popular opinion. All the signs of someone who’s passionately believes in their purpose and competence.
2)      Purpose – We may not know for sure what she believes is her purpose but one thing is clear she does believe that our political system needs a shake up and she’s the woman to do the shaking.
 
3)      Decisive – The Republican Party (and for that matter every other party) is split and non-functional. Before you jump down my throat just take a look at the last mid-term elections. In spite of record turnouts for the Presidential elections voters were disenchanted and simply not engaged with the November elections. The spirited debates, the call to action and the interest in the candidates was missing in action folks. That’s an opportunity for someone who can electrify the populist. And she sees the opportunity and is willing to go after it.  
 
4)      A Plan – We may not know it but it looks like she knows where she’s going and is flexible enough to capitalize on whatever comes her way.
 
5)      Lastly, her execution appears efficient and (at least for right now) effective. Time will tell whether she’s good at execution. However one thing is for sure. The final judgment on how well she executes is determined by Sarah Palin not us. Only she can say whether, in the end, she achieved her goals. Just look at Al Gore. One door closed for him and he opened another and today by his own admission is happy, following his passion and making money doing it.
 
Hmmm?!? Given what we know about success, I’d say this lady has what it takes.
